About The Position

This position will oversee HRIS business partnership, system delivery, and stakeholder engagement activities while managing a team including an HRIS Business Partner and HRIS Manager, with dotted-line collaboration across HRIS analysts. The role partners closely with senior HR leadership, IT, and business stakeholders to align HR technology capabilities with organizational priorities and drive measurable value through system optimization, analytics, and process improvement. Utilizing a data-driven and service-oriented approach, this leader will enhance HR operational efficiency, streamline workflows, improve user experience, and ensure scalable and secure HR technology solutions — most significantly within the Workday ecosystem. Requirements

  • Bachelor’s degree in HR, Information Systems, Business Administration, or related field (advanced degree preferred)
  • 5–10+ years of progressive HRIS or HR technology experience
  • Demonstrated leadership experience managing HRIS teams or business partner functions
  • Strong Workday expertise including configuration, reporting, integrations, and module functionality
  • Experience supporting multi-entity or shared services environments preferred
  • Proven stakeholder partnership and influence skills across organizational levels
  • Strong analytical mindset with ability to translate business needs into technical solutions
  • Experience leading HRIS or technology-related projects and implementations
  • Knowledge of HR data governance, security practices, and regulatory considerations
  • Exceptional communication and interpersonal skills

Responsibilities

  • Strategic Leadership & Technology Enablement
  • Translate enterprise HR technology strategy into executable roadmaps, priorities, and delivery plans
  • Partner with senior leadership to align HRIS initiatives with business and HR objectives
  • Provide strategic guidance on optimizing Workday usage, module adoption, and system capabilities
  • Identify opportunities to enhance efficiency, scalability, and employee experience through technology solutions
  • Participate in HR strategy discussions as the operational SME for HR systems and data capabilities
  • Stakeholder Partnership & Governance
  • Serve as a senior escalation and partnership point for operating companies and internal stakeholders
  • Ensure effective intake, prioritization, and governance of HR technology requests
  • Guide stakeholders on leveraging HRIS solutions to improve processes and outcomes
  • Communicate system updates, enhancements, and roadmap progress across the organization
  • Build strong cross-functional partnerships with IT, HR leaders, and business teams
  • Delivery Oversight & Execution
  • Oversee configuration, integrations, reporting, and system functionality within Workday
  • Ensure delivery of enhancements, implementations, and integrations across modules including Core HCM, Compensation, Talent, and Benefits
  • Lead project execution from planning through deployment and adoption
  • Monitor delivery progress, risks, and dependencies to ensure successful outcomes
  • Ensure documentation, controls, and compliance within systems of record
  • Analytics, Reporting & Data Integrity
  • Partner with leadership and IT to advance HR analytics capabilities
  • Support development and delivery of dashboards, reporting, and actionable insights
  • Ensure HR data integrity, security, and regulatory compliance
  • Promote data-driven decision making across stakeholders
  • Drive continuous improvement in reporting and analytics maturity
  • Team Leadership & Development
  • Lead and develop the HRIS function including:
  • HRIS Business Partner
  • HRIS Manager
  • Dotted-line collaboration with HRIS analysts
  • Set clear priorities, performance expectations, and development plans
  • Foster a culture of collaboration, accountability, and service excellence
  • Provide coaching, mentorship, and leadership support
  • Ensure team alignment with enterprise strategy and service model
